Will the iPhone be available through Verizon Wireless?
The iPhone will be released exclusively through Cingular Wireless. Cingular obtained a multi-year exclusivity on the iPhone before Apple started work on the project. It’s an exclusive multiyear agreement, which means no other carrier will be able to sell the iPhone through 2009. Cingular is a GSM-based network, so Apple would also have to develop a CDMA based iPhone to be compatible with Verizon Wireless. Depending on the popularity of the iPhone, you can expect Verizon Wireless to pursue an agreement with Apple when the exclusivity ends.
